owenzhang的博客

删除svn目录

字数统计: 167阅读时长: 1 min
2012/02/16
loading

当向svn添加目录时,如果目录下有.svn目录,会出现冲突。

所以在引用代码时总是先删除掉.svn目录,使用以下命令。

[code lang=”cpp”]
find . -name “.svn” -exec rm -rf {} ;

find . -name “.svn” | xargs rm -rf
[/code]

具体的含义可以参考《find命令总结》

find命令将所有匹配到的文件一起传递给exec执行,有些系统对能够传递给exec的命令长度有限制,这样在find命令运行几分钟之后,就会出现溢出错误。

注意:在删除文件前最好先打印一下查找到的文件,核对下是否是要删除的。

CATALOG